![]() Information about skylights and mulled units is not exported. Doors and Windows - The Assembly type, Orientation, Gross Area, U-Factor, and Solar Heat Gain Coefficient (SHGC) are exported.The On Center Spacing of Framed walls is derived from the framing material assigned to the wall type’s Main Layer. Like walls on the same floor are grouped by orientation. All are exported as Walls rather than Basement or Crawl Walls. Walls - The Assembly type, Orientation, Gross Area, and Cavity and Continuous R-Values are exported.Ceilings - The Assembly type, Gross Area, and Cavity and Continuous R-Values are exported.Slab Depth of Insulation is not included and must be entered manually. Slabs on Grade - The Slab Perimeter and Continuous R-Value are exported.Floors - The Assembly type, Gross Area, and Cavity and Continuous R-Values are exported.Nearly all REScheck Envelope data can be exported from a Chief Architect plan: Location and Title/Site/Permit are not exportable In a REScheck report exported from Chief Architect, the Project Type is set as “New Construction” and “1-and-2 Family, Detached” is selected under Building Characteristics. The Designer Contractor information is drawn from the plan file’s Designer Information.The Owner/Agent information is drawn from the plan file’s Client Information.The Conditioned Floor Area is calculated and exported by Chief Architect.Front Faces - The side of the house that faces down on-screen is considered the front, and North is considered up on-screen unless a North Pointer is used.For more information, visit: Ĭhief Architect can export the following REScheck Project data: Department of Energy that evaluates the thermal envelope of a structure and determines how well it meets various energy codes.
